feat: LAPI metrics v2, processed traffic tracking, and Grafana dashboard v32 (#7)
## Summary
Enhanced metrics reporting with per-IP-type labels, processed traffic
tracking via passthrough firewall rules, and updated Grafana dashboard.
## Changes
### LAPI Metrics v2
- Enrich LAPI usage metrics with `ip_type` labels (`ipv4`, `ipv6`) for
dropped/processed counters
- Per-IP-type delta tracking for accurate LAPI reporting
### Passthrough Counting Rules
- Automatically create passthrough firewall rules (filter + raw) to
count processed traffic (bytes/packets)
- Rules are placed before the bouncer drop rules using `PlaceBefore` for
accurate counting
- Supports both IPv4 and IPv6 chains
### Prometheus Processed Traffic Metrics
- 4 new Prometheus gauges: `crowdsec_routeros_processed_bytes` and
`crowdsec_routeros_processed_packets` (per `ip_version` and
`chain_type`)
- Metrics are collected from the passthrough counting rules on each
reconciliation cycle
### Configurable `track_processed`
- New `metrics.track_processed` config option (default: `true`,
advanced)
- When disabled, skips creation of counting rules and omits processed
metrics from Prometheus and LAPI
- Documented in configuration reference and Grafana guide
### Grafana Dashboard v32
- Synced from live Grafana (40→50 panels) with new processed traffic
panels
- Templatized all datasource UIDs (`${DS_PROMETHEUS}`) with
`__inputs`/`__requires` for portable import
- Updated dark/light screenshots for documentation
## Testing
- Unit tests updated for new metrics and config options
- Functional tests cover passthrough rule creation and processed metric
collection
- `go vet` passes cleanly

### The i18n parity gate is rewritten onto the MDX AST
It had produced **three defects in one area** — an HTML-comment
terminator that missed `--!>`, a chained-replace sanitisation that left
a bare `<!--` behind, and a one-character backtick delimiter that leaked
double-backtick spans. Two were found by CodeQL, one in review. Three
findings in one file say the approach is wrong, not that the patches
were bad; parsing makes those classes unreachable.
All four parser packages were **already resolved in the lockfile**, so
declaring them added nothing to install.
Verified by a **differential harness over all 56 corpus files across six
dimensions**, which caught a regression the rewrite introduced and
surfaced a genuine improvement: three multi-path `ConfigOption`
invocations that used to collapse into one indistinguishable bucket are
now keyed individually. Demonstrated: a Spanish page pointing at a
non-existent config path **passed** the old gate and fails the new one.
It also corrected a claim the old file asserted: an HTML comment closed
with `--!>` is **not** closed for the renderer. CommonMark ends an HTML
block only at `-->`, so the earlier "fix" was wrong in the other
direction.
### A new mark
The shield is gone. Rendered side by side at the sizes that matter it
was, unmistakably, **the WiFi glyph** — a shield containing concentric
arcs radiating from a dot is the standard signal icon at 104px and at
23px. Nobody noticed until the candidates were laid out and looked at.
For a network tool that is worse than generic; it is misleading.
What replaces it: four lanes meeting a rail, three crossing and
continuing, one stopping dead at it. The proportion is deliberate — a
firewall does not block everything, it blocks the exception. **Three
primitives, 282 bytes of geometry, no ids, no defs, no mask**, against
the 3.8 KB the shield needed.
Chosen from 29 candidates across two waves. The first wave's five
directions all came from the data side — list, chain, loop, flow — and
its winner drew a generic list; the siblings anchor on a git ref and an
open book, objects that only exist in their domains. The second wave
entered through the domain and beat it on all four judging lenses.
### The accent moves to CrowdSec's indigo
`#4d4a98` light, `#807dc0` dark — the same hue and saturation raised
until it clears 4.5:1 against the **surface** rather than merely the
page. The page-only value failed twice, on the terminal prompt glyph and
the sidebar pill, and the contrast gate caught both.
This is ecosystem alignment, not a return to the co-branding retired
earlier: that palette paired CrowdSec indigo *with* MikroTik teal,
implying endorsement by two vendors including the hardware one. This is
a CrowdSec bouncer, listed on their Hub. **Worth checking their brand
guidelines before a release goes out.**
The rail takes the accent because the boundary is what the product is.
Pass and stop are carried by **length before colour**: the accent and
the muted tone measure 1.19:1 apart, so a mark relying on that pair to
tell them apart would come very close to collapsing into one tone in
greyscale.
CrowdSec's amber moves to `--rb-status-warn`, where it does semantic
work rather than decorating.
### Four architecture diagrams, under one convention
The rule-placement ladder, the decision funnel in three swimlanes, the
reconciliation diff and the shutdown order. Solid is a write, dashed is
a read, carried on three channels — line pattern, then colour, then a
legend inside each diagram — so they survive greyscale, colour vision
deficiency and a printout.
Six accuracy defects in them were corrected against the Go source. One
claim was rewritten rather than deleted: entries whose comment does not
match the prefix were described as "never listed", but `ListAddresses`
queries on the list name alone and filters client-side, so they **are**
fetched every pass and only then dropped — which costs transfer on a
list an operator may be sharing.
### Navigation
Sidebar depth hierarchy, pagination that names its destination (two
entries were both labelled "Overview"), scroll-into-view, and a **mobile
theme toggle** — there was none, the header hid the control below 50rem.
It never writes `data-theme` or `localStorage` itself: it drives
Starlight's own select and reads state back via a MutationObserver,
because anything else desynchronises from the desktop control and the
before-paint script.
